Norway is famous for its Linie Aquavit, so called because it is shipped to Australia and back (across the Equator, or the "Line") in oak containers to produce mellow flavour.
Oh, since I'm at it. What is Aquavit? from Medieval Latin aqua vitae, "water of life",
A Scandinavian flavoured, distilled liquor, ranging in alcohol content from about 42 to 45 percent by volume, clear to pale yellow in colour, distilled from a fermented potato or grain mash, flavored with caraway seeds or cumin seed, others that may be used are lemon or orange peel, cardamom, aniseed, and fennel.
You are right, the Linie Aquavit has to be sailed over the equator to be rightfully named Linie Aquavit.. Quite expensive prosess I guess, but hey, traditions are important here :)))
So every bottle of Linie Aquavit has crossed the equator in some kind of ship :)
They found out that the time it took to sail down to equator and back was the perfect time for the Aquavit to be ready for our tables.. Now a days the ships are moving faster, and they sail the cargo all the way to Australia and back.. off course it has no purpose for the taste, but traditions has to live :)
